2,4-Quinolinediol
AlkaPlorer ID: AK009976
Synonym: 4-Hydroxy-2(1H)-quinolinone, 4-Hydroxycarbostyril, 2,4-Dihydroxyquinoline, 2-Hydroxy-4(1H)-quinolinone, 2,4(1H,3H)-Quinolinedione
IUPAC Name: 4-hydroxy-1H-quinolin-2-one
Structure
SMILES: OC1=CC(O)=C2C=CC=CC2=N1
InChI: InChI=1S/C9H7NO2/c11-8-5-9(12)10-7-4-2-1-3-6(7)8/h1-5H,(H2,10,11,12)
InChIKey: HDHQZCHIXUUSMK-UHFFFAOYSA-N
Source
| Species | Genus | Family | Order | Class | Phylum | Kingdom | Domain |
|---|---|---|---|---|---|---|---|
| Haplophyllum bucharicum | Haplophyllum | Rutaceae | Sapindales | Magnoliopsida | Streptophyta | Viridiplantae | Eukaryota |
Properties Information
Molecule Weight: 161.15999999999997
TPSA?: 53.35
MolLogP?: 1.6459999999999992
Number of H-Donors: 2
Number of H-Acceptors: 3
RingCount: 2
Activities Information
| Organism | Target Name | Standard Type | Standard Value | Standard Units | doi |
|---|---|---|---|---|---|
| Homo sapiens | Aldehyde dehydrogenase 1A1 | Potency | 5011.9 | nM | None |
| Homo sapiens | Geminin | Potency | 8199.5 | nM | None |
| Homo sapiens | Guanine nucleotide-binding protein G(s), subunit alpha | Potency | 3981.1 | nM | None |
| Homo sapiens | Histone-lysine N-methyltransferase, H3 lysine-9 specific 3 | Potency | 79432.8 | nM | None |
| Homo sapiens | Lysine-specific demethylase 4D-like | Potency | 39810.7 | nM | None |
| Mycobacterium tuberculosis | Mycobacterium tuberculosis | Inhibition | 0.0 | % | 10.1016/j.bmcl.2006.09.082 |
| Trichophyton benhamiae | Trichophyton benhamiae | MIC | 500000000.0 | nM | 10.1016/j.bmcl.2006.09.082 |
